// Max age (days) before the Hollowbrook sweeper purges inactive
// records. Do not raise without legal sign-off. Sweeper runs
// nightly; deletes are tombstoned for 30 days, then hard-removed.
// Changing this constant triggers a full re-scan on next run,
// which is expensive. History: lowered from 120 to 90 in the
// retention audit. The originating build is recorded below.

build token for kagaf-hahof: htk14_9d3d4d26d7d8de

## Runbook: Extracting the user module from Corewagon

When splitting the user module out of the Corewagon monolith, first freeze schema migrations on the shared users table, then enable dual-write mode so both the monolith and the new Usertide service receive updates. Verify parity with the drift checker before cutting reads over. The new service authenticates against the internal identity broker; maintainers running the migration scripts will need its API key. For convenience, the current key is included below.

API key for yahig-tadup: kto7_ubizbYm

Meterdeck enforces per-tenant quotas at the gateway, and every release can change quota math, so treat these deploys carefully. Before shipping, run the quota simulator against the staging tenant set and confirm no tenant's effective limit drops by more than 5% without a linked approval ticket. If a tenant is mid-incident, freeze their quota tier first — on-call has authority to do this unilaterally. When the checks pass, the release bundle must be signed with the gateway deploy key, included below for convenience.

deploy key for kajof-fajop: bky6_gDHw9Q